Electric Vehicle Drivetrains: A Focus on Precision Shafts
The increasing adoption of the automotive industry has placed a significant emphasis on high-performance drivetrain components. Among these, precision shaft manufacturing plays a essential role in ensuring smooth power delivery from the electric motor to the wheels. EV drivetrains demand shafts that exhibit exceptional rigidity coupled with precise tolerances to minimize friction and maximize output. Manufacturers are continually exploring the boundaries of shaft design and manufacturing processes to meet these demanding requirements.
- Aspects such as material selection, heat treatment, machining accuracy, and surface quality all contribute to the overall performance and lifespan of EV drivetrain shafts.
- Sophisticated manufacturing techniques like CNC turning, grinding, and honing are employed to achieve the high levels of accuracy required in EV shaft production.
- Moreover, ongoing research and development efforts are focused on incorporating lightweight materials like carbon fiber composites into shaft designs to further improve efficiency and capabilities.
